2) They focus on the most profitable aspects of their businesses
Part of growing a successful online business is knowing which revenue streams are paying the bills. Over time, many businesses will launch a variety of products and services in order to maximize earnings potential and create growth. Our most successful clients monitor their revenue streams closely so they can see which ones are providing the most financial benefit. We ’ve seen other online entrepreneurs grow their product and service offerings too quickly, spreading themselves and their teams very thin as they try to chase every dollar that comes their way. That ’s where utilizing the sales data from your CRM can be hugely helpful to focus your sales and marketing efforts on the revenue streams that support the business the most.

5) They take calculated risks
Most online entrepreneurs know that taking risks is part of the game. Going into business for yourself is a big enough gamble as it is, but most of our clients know that taking risks doesn ’t have to be a sink or swim situation. They never invest more than their business can afford and they take baby steps when moving into territory they haven ’t traversed before (new product launches, services, ways of running the business, etc.). Much of being an entrepreneur revolves around failing, but it ’s important to make sure those failures don ’t break the bank or put your current success at risk.

8) They keep their personal and business finances separate
When you ’re running an online business, it ’s easy for your personal life and business life to intermingle, especially when it comes to your finances. If you ’re using only one bank account for both business and personal use, your financials become cloudy and complicated. This also makes your bookkeeping and accounting more convoluted, which can increase your accounting bill at the end of the year and make it easier to miss out on tax write-offs. It ’s amazing how much more focused and clear your business becomes when you separate it from the rest of your financial life.
9) They live within the means that their businesses provide them
If you don ’t think your personal expenses have an effect on how you run your business, you are mistaken. Our most successful clients understand this better than most, making sure to live within the means that their business provides them. This way, if they have a slow month on the business side, they aren ’t scrambling to pay their bills in their personal life. After all, the more money you take out of the business to pay yourself, the less money you have to invest back into the business to help it grow.
